Far Eastern University remains undefeated in men’s basketball after it trashed University of the East on Sunday, 92-66, at the Mall of Asia Arena in Pasay.
Ending the game with a huge 26-point lead, the Tamaraws easily extended their winning streak to four with the reliable tandem of RR Garcia and Terrence Romeo leading them.
The Red Warriors, who managed to dominate the first quarter with a four point advantage, failed to forward successfully after that. Roi Sumang chipped in eight points out of the 18 they fielded.
Tamaraw Chris Tolomia opened the second quarter with a three and teammate Garcia followed up a few seconds after to change the lead into their favor. FEU continued their onslaught with Anthony Hargrove also stepping up to bulldoze UE.
The next quarter was again opened with a triple, now coming from Garcia. Multiple fouls also opened free throws for the winning team.
In the final quarter, Garcia and Romeo were back on a roll with Gryann Mendoza following. Fellow Tamaraw Reymar Jose finishes the game with a jumper at the last second.
FEU be battling National University next for a possible fifth straight win while UE will again attempt for their first win with Ateneo de Manila University.
